Understanding Car Key Refurbishment: An In-Depth Guide

With the increasing complexity of modern-day vehicle key innovation, car key refurbishment has actually become a vital service for car owners. As vehicles have progressed from simple mechanical locks to advanced electronic systems, the requirement to maintain and repair car keys has become necessary to guarantee smooth vehicle operation. In this article, we will dig into the aspects of car key refurbishment, its benefits, common types of refurbishment services, and the regularly asked questions associated to the subject.

What is Car Key Refurbishment?

car key refurbishment, click the following document, is the process of fixing, restoring, or updating vehicle keys to guarantee they operate effectively. This can involve changing worn-out elements, reprogramming electronic chips, and even changing the key shell. The main objective is to extend the life expectancy of the key and improve its reliability, ultimately conserving car owners from substantial replacement expenses.

When is Car Key Refurbishment Necessary?

There are several scenarios under which car key refurbishment might be essential. These include:

  1. Worn Key Blades: Over time, key blades can become worn and may not turn smoothly in locks.
  2. Functionality Issues: Keys that fail to respond when pressed, or fobs that do not unlock or start the vehicle.
  3. Physical Damage: Cracked or broken key shells that can jeopardize the key's functionality.
  4. Battery Replacement: For electronic keys and key fobs, battery replacement is a common refurbishment service.
  5. Reprogramming Needs: Occasionally, keys might require to be reprogrammed due to malfunction or after altering vehicle security systems.

Kinds Of Car Key Refurbishment Services

Car key refurbishment encompasses a range of services, as detailed below:

Type of ServiceDescription
Key CuttingReproducing a new key from an existing one, specifically if the original is used down.
Chip ReprogrammingReprogramming the transponder chip to sync with the vehicle's electronic systems.
Battery ReplacementChanging the battery in key fobs or smart keys to make sure functionality.
Shell ReplacementChanging broken or broken external shells of keys, preserving internal elements.
Blade ReplacementReplacing the physical key blade when it is broken or excessively worn.
Remote Key RepairFixing problems with the push-button control functions, consisting of buttons and interaction signals.

The Car Key Refurbishment Process

The procedure of car key refurbishment can differ based upon the service required, however it usually follows these general steps:

  1. Assessment: A qualified technician checks the key to figure out the necessary repairs or replacements.
  2. Repair/Replacement: Depending on the assessment, the technician carries out the required services, such as cutting a new key, reprogramming, or changing batteries.
  3. Evaluating: After refurbishment, the key undergoes screening to ensure it operates correctly in all pertinent situations, consisting of unlocking doors and starting the engine.
  4. Last Delivery: The totally refurbished key is restored to the owner, total with a warranty for the service offered.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Key Refurbishment

1. How long does car key refurbishment take?

A lot of refurbishment services can be finished within a few hours, although complex reprogramming or repairs may take longer.

2. Is car key refurbishment cheaper than replacement?

Yes, for the most part, reconditioning a key is considerably more affordable than changing it. Prices can vary based upon the type and level of the refurbishment needed.

3. Can any key be reconditioned?

While numerous standard keys can be refurbished, some high-security and smart keys might need specific services.

4. What should I do if my key stops working?

If a key stops to work, it is recommended to seek advice from an expert locksmith or key technician to examine whether it can be refurbished.

5. Exist any indications my key needs refurbishment?

Common signs include trouble in placing the key, repeated stopped working attempts to start the vehicle, or noticeable wear and tear on the key itself.
